Re: the current park board thread. Members are reminded that our rules require discussions be of a "substantive and respectful nature." We don't have any problems with substance on the thread, but I do sense degrading respect.
I ask that all the combatants take a step back, resist using words like "hate mail" and "slanderous." We often disagree - this is the place for that - but here we have to do so respectfully. In conflict-ridden threads such as these, resist extreme characterizations and labels - if you have the facts on your side, the strength of your argument should be enough. Also, a reminder about list rule, #5, that states "One-on-one arguments, disagreements, and disputes of a personal nature must be taken off list." Asking about a specific member's paycheck is a bit too close to a personal attack, the sort of intimidation that keeps people from participating Generally, I ask that members try to address their issue-based remarks to the forum, not to each other...that helps reduce nasty personalization and avoid one-on-one disputes. If you want to invite each other to coffee, facetiously or not, or check each others' pay stubs, please have that conversation off-list.
